Permanent magnet motor rotor structure for enhancing shielding effect of harmonic magnetic field
A shielding, permanent magnet motor technology, applied in the shape/pattern/structure of the magnetic circuit, shielding the electromagnetic field, rotating parts of the magnetic circuit, etc., can solve the problems such as the inability to effectively suppress the eddy current at the rotor end, the overheating of the rotor end, and the demagnetization. , to achieve the effect of suppressing eddy current loss, reducing eddy current loss, and high conductivity

[0031] Such as figure 1 As shown, the rotor structure of the existing common surface-mounted permanent magnet motor includes the rotating shaft 1, the rotor core 2, the permanent magnet 3, the shielding layer 4 and the rotor sheath 5 from the inside to the outside.
